News

Meta executives are reportedly acknowledging a serious new problem with scams affecting its social media platforms.
Some content creators claim they’re making thousands in “passive” income showing off products on social media.
Fake puppies and phony offers of mouthwatering bargains are often seeded by overseas crime networks; employees say company is ...